(c)1967 Words & Music by Graham Gouldman.
This song about a love that is lost became a hit in 1968, a few month after its release, when the American public turned away from The Beatles after John Lennon's statements that the Beatles had become more popular than Jesus.

According to the Stylus magazine (June 2006), this "Is quite possibly the most compacted structure of any song from the period. Not that you might notice. The tune is so clever that it manages some perceptual tricks. If you are at all familiar with 'No Milk Today,' you may be surprised to learn that it is comprised of 16 sections."
